A Product Owner is responsible for maximizing the value of the product by managing and prioritizing the backlog to align with business goals and customer needs. They act as the key liaison between stakeholders and the delivery team, ensuring requirements are clearly defined and understood. They also make decisions on scope and priorities to guide the team toward delivering the most valuable outcomes. Key responsibilities:

Connecting with the Customer
o Be keenly aware of the needs of the people to whom the products are delivered.
o Understand and reflect the needs of non-customer stakeholders who rely on the cadence and quality of the team’s output.
o Identify problems that customers want to be solved through different thinking tools, then identify the ‘jobs to be done’ that are most worth pursuing.
2. Contributing to the Vision and Roadmap
o Regularly engage with Product Management to analyse market research and understand the business drivers that trigger work requests.
o Ensure that the vision and roadmap contain real value by representing the end user, their needs and experience of using the products.
o Assist with ART backlog prioritization by collaborating with key roles and stakeholders to guide the sequencing of features over time.
o Assist with communicating the vision and roadmap during planning events to ensure teams are aligned.
3. Managing and Prioritizing the Team Backlog
o Guide story creation by ensuring they are well-formed and aligned with product strategy, backlog refinement. Proven track record producing high quality user stories and acceptance criteria
o Clarify story details using product ownership tools and techniques such as user-story voice, INVEST, and BDD.
o Prioritize backlog items by regularly ordering backlog items according to their cost of delay, and communicate the sequence to the team
o Accept stories by validating that stories meet their Definition of Done to assure that quality is built in.
4. Support the Team in Delivering Value
o Balance stakeholder perspectives by receiving feedback and insights, understanding the drivers and collaborating with stakeholders and teams to make implementation decisions that produce the most favourable outcomes.
o Elaborate stories before and during the iteration to help the team increase velocity and shorten learning cycles.
o Attend and actively participate in team and ART events.
5. Getting and Applying Feedback
o Mitigate the risk of developing solutions with little value by collaborating with Product Management to define benefit hypotheses that drive implementation.
o Obtain feedback from customers and stakeholders that indicates how well the solutions meet their needs.
